Transaction 0434c21e70980b92c022616634962176df6b2418e4882790a4ed750084ba60f9
1 Input
2 Outputs
- 0434c21e70980b92c022616634962176df6b2418e4882790a4ed750084ba60f9:0
- 0434c21e70980b92c022616634962176df6b2418e4882790a4ed750084ba60f9:1
value 3125166136
address 1BKpc6MkdfEx4Zaz7YsK5Xx2SSARTmbncp
value 37670094
address 3Ee8QNvWf9o4u248yKBBBoBYaNNwBZXKNB